About the Role

As a Talent Engagement Partner, you'll play a vital role in supporting candidates through the onboarding journey, ensuring they are fully compliant and ready to start work with our clients.

You'll manage a variety of pre-employment checks including references, Right to Work verification and other compliance requirements, while providing an exceptional experience for candidates and stakeholders alike.

Working across a range of client accounts, you'll be part of a collaborative team that supports one another to meet deadlines and deliver outstanding service.

What You'll Be Doing

  • Managing candidate onboarding activities from offer acceptance through to start date.

  • Processing and reviewing pre-employment screening and compliance checks.

  • Conducting Right to Work verification activities.

  • Liaising with candidates, hiring managers and internal stakeholders.

  • Monitoring onboarding progress and proactively resolving issues.

  • Managing multiple priorities and meeting tight deadlines.

  • Supporting colleagues across the wider Talent Engagement team as required.

  • Delivering a positive and professional candidate experience at every stage.
